Italian Trade Commission

The Italian Institute for Foreign Trade (I.C.E., Istituto nazionale per il Commercio Estero) is the Italian government agency entrusted with the promotion of trade, business opportunities and industrial co-operation between Italian and foreign companies.

COM.IT.ES

COM.IT.ES (Acronym of Italian words for Committee of Italians Abroad) is a Los Angeles-based California non profit organization that collaborates with the Italian Consular Authorities to safeguard the rights and interests of the Italian citizens residing within the area of jurisdiction of the Italian Consulate General of Los Angeles.

The members of COM.IT.ES Board of Directors are Italian nationals elected by fellow Italian nationals residing in the area.

COM.IT.ES, in collaboration with the Italian Consular Authorities, the Italian Regional government offices, and local organizations promotes the interests of the local Italian community by organizing social and cultural events, and by offering assistance in matters such as schooling, training, entertainment and spare time.
